Recently, the theft of baby food from superstore in the capital by an unemployed father drew a lot of attention in the social media. Many read the incident as failure to the government’s much publicised development programmes that contributed to GDP growth, but failed to generate employment for youth and bridge income inequality. Students share their thoughts on the incident on the backdrop of government’s development narratives with New Age Youth
